Features to fall in love with ..
What Others Say About HappyFiles
Download HappyFiles
Download the free version of HappyFiles to manage up to 10 media folders. Want to manage unlimited folders, all your post types, enable SVG uploads & sanitization? Then choose one of the HappyFiles Pro lifetime deals below:
-
HappyFiles Pro (STARTER)
25$19*- Use On 1 Website
- Manage Unlimited Folders
- Categorize Any Post Type
- SVG Upload, Sanitization, Preview
- Priority Support
- One-Click Plugin Updates
- Whitelist/Blacklist Websites
- Early Access To Updates
- Support The Developer :)
-
HappyFiles Pro (BUSINESS)
49$39*- Use On 5 Websites
- Manage Unlimited Folders
- Categorize Any Post Type
- SVG Upload, Sanitization, Preview
- Priority Support
- One-Click Plugin Updates
- Whitelist/Blacklist Websites
- Early Access To Updates
- Support The Developer :)
-
BEST VALUE
HappyFiles Pro (UNLIMITED)
79$59*- Use On All Your Websites
- Manage Unlimited Folders
- Categorize Any Post Type
- SVG Upload, Sanitization, Preview
- Priority Support
- One-Click Plugin Updates
- Whitelist/Blacklist Websites
- Early Access To Updates
- Support The Developer :)
* Prices in US Dollar (excl. VAT). No VAT applied for non-EU customers. EU-businesses with a valid VAT ID can deduct VAT during checkout.
100 Days Money-Back-Guarantee
I am 100% confident that you'll love the HappyFiles PRO experience. But if you'd like a refund (for whatever reason) just let me know, and I will issue you a full refund within 24 hours. So far only 3 customers ever asked for a refund.
Highest Rated Media Manager Plugin on WordPress.org
Tested for 5 mins, then purchased the Pro.
"Our test site had 800+ images, and by using this plugin, it was ridiculously quick to organise them without the default media gallery slowdown. Was genuinely surprised how quick it is, and was expecting a major slow down or lag. If you are a dev, its a no brainer to purchase the Pro version with lifetime license." - @killerbeez
Frequently Asked Questions
How do I create and manage unlimited media categories?
The free version of HappyFiles is limited to a maximum of 10 media categories. Get HappyFiles Pro to create and manage unlimited media categories.
Can I use HappyFiles on all my sites?
HappyFiles Pro (Unlimited) allows for one-click updates on all your sites and your client sites.
If you have purchased the Starter license you can enable one-click updates on 1 site. The Business license allows one-click updates for up to 5 sites.
If you want to upgrade to a bigger plan, please get in touch via email (info@happyfiles.io).
How does HappyFiles create folders on my site?
No actual folders are created on your server. HappyFiles creates custom taxonomy terms to store and assign categories to files and post types.
Is it possible to upload a file directly into a category?
First select the category you want to upload your files into. Then simply upload your file.
How do I remove a category from an item?
Simply drag and drop the item into the "All Categories" or "Uncategorised" folder ;)
How can I create a gallery from my categories?
You can created dynamic galleries from your categories by using the "HappyFiles Gallery" Gutenberg block, or via the HappyFiles shortcode.
The [happyfiles_gallery] shortcode has the following parameters:
- categories: comma separated list of category names, slugs, or IDs (recommended to use IDs as they don't change)
- max: Specify the max. number of images you want to show (default: shows all images)
- columns: Number of columns of your gallery (1 - 6)
- orderBy: date (default), none, ID, author, name, title, type, modified, rand
- order: ASC (ascending), DESC (descending)
- imageSize: thumbnail, medium, large, full
- linkTo: attachment, media, none (default)
-
includeChildren: Set to true to show images of sub categories
- crop: Set to true to crop your images (true by default)
- caption: Set to true to show image caption (false by default)
- lightbox: Set to true to show open your images in a browsable image lightbox
- lightboxFullscreen: Set to true to add fullscreen functionality to your lightbox (optional)
- lightboxThumbnails: Set to true to add thumbnail navigation to your lightbox (optional)
- lightboxZoom: Set to true to add zoom functionality to your lightbox (optional)
Let's say you want to create a gallery that shows all the images of your media folders named "Cabins" and "Nature" in a four columns gallery, and link every image to its media file. The shortcode you'd use would be:
[happyfiles_gallery categories="Cabins, Nature" columns="4" linkTo="media"]
Can I try HappyFiles before purchasing the Pro version?
Of course. You can download HappyFiles for free from the official WordPress repository and manage up to 10 media categories.
Do you have a public roadmap?
Yes, you can view the current development process for HappyFiles on https://happyfiles.io/roadmap/
How can I submit feature requests?
HappyFiles development is 100% user-driven. You can view, upvote and submit your own feature requests on https://happyfiles.io/roadmap/?tab=ideas. Ideas with the most upvotes are developed first.
Get In Touch
info [at] happyfiles [dot] io
For all your pre-sale, customer support, and partnership questions. Or just to say Hi :)
The more details you provide when submitting a support request (screenshots, screencast, etc.) the better I can assist you.

Thomas Ehrig
HappyFiles Developer
I'll try to get back to you in the next 24 hours.